Math

What is the last digit of 3^{3^3} ?

(A) 1
(B) 3
(C) 6
(D) 7
(E) 9

Question Discussion & Explanation
Correct Answer - D - (click and drag your mouse to see the answer)

Verbal

In 1971, pioneering journalist Helen Thomas, [u]who the National Press Club had just elected as their first female member[/u], delivered an inspirational speech to the Club’s male members when they gathered to congratulate her after the votes were counted.

(A) who the National Press Club had just elected as their first female member

(B) whom the National Press Club just elected as its first female member

(C) who had just been elected by the National Press Club as its first female member

(D) whom the National Press Club elected as its first female member

(E) who the National Press Club had just elected as their first female member

Question Discussion & Explanation
Correct Answer - C - (click and drag your mouse to see the answer)
